Book Summary: In The Face Of Recent Viral Outbreaks And A Global Viral Pandemic, The Necessity For Innovation And Continued Rapid Advancement In Viral Diagnosis And Treatment Methods Has Become Even More Apparent. Global Virology IV: Viral Disease Diagnosis And Treatment Delivery In The 21st Century Explores The Latest Advances In Virology And Trends In Clinical Practice, Focused On Foundational Principles And Advancements Expected To Significantly Impact This Field. Chapters Address SARS-CoV-2, Ebola, Zika, Mpox, And Hepatitis C, Among Other Key Viral Threats, Before Presenting A Detailed Analysis Of Antiviral Agents Broadly And Concerning Specific Vulnerable Populations Such As Stem Cell And Solid Organ Transplant Recipients. It Is Designed As A Helpful Resource For Medical Students, Scientists, And Professionals, Bridging Current Practice And Future Applications And Inspiring Further Innovations And Improvements In Global Health.
